The lovely house party she had planned with such hope was entirely spoiled after the wretched debacle last night. Her own daughter, caught in a very compromising situation with a notorious rake! Even worse, a rake she had been forewarned against for over a decade. Rosalind had allowed David to invite the young man to Ainsley Park years ago because David had told her his friend had nowhere else to go on holidays. Although the young Langford—Rosalind simply could not think of him any other way, no... matter how he styled himself now—had never behaved any worse than David’s other friends, there had always been something about him that made her wary, a feeling that although he was with David and the other young men, he wasn’t really one of them, that he was somehow a bit removed from them. A lone wolf, she had always thought of him, and she had eventually told David not to invite him again, all for the sake of protecting her growing lamb.
    And now…It made her almost ill to see the way Celia watched him.
